“…Vadim Ponomarenko and coworkers [Adams et al 2009] introduced and studied the notion of bifurcus semigroups, a class of semigroups with "bad" factorization properties: a semigroup S is bifurcus if every nonunit nonatom can be bifurcated, that is, expressed as the product of exactly two atoms in S. They gave examples, showed that certain important families of semigroups cannot be bifurcus, and calculated several factorization-theoretic invariants of bifurcus semigroups. Further examples of bifurcus semigroups can be found in .…”
